The Apache Tomcat team announces the immediate availability of Apache
Tomcat 8.5.58.

Apache Tomcat 8 is an open source software implementation of the Java
Servlet, JavaServer Pages, Java Unified Expression Language, Java
WebSocket and Java Authentication Service Provider Interface for
Containers technologies.

Apache Tomcat 8.5.x replaces 8.0.x and includes new features pulled
forward from the 9.0.x branch. The notable changes since 8.5.57 include:

- For requests containing the Expect: 100-continue header, optional
  support has been added to delay sending an intermediate 100 status
  response until the servlet reads the request body, allowing the
  servlet the opportunity to respond without asking for the request
  body. Based on a pull request by malaysf.

- Add support for a read idle timeout and a write idle timeout to the
  WebSocket session via custom properties in the user properties
  instance associated with the session. Based on a pull request by
  sakshamverma.

- Update the packaged version of the Tomcat Native Library to 1.2.25
